Combined U.S., Salvadoran team assesses damage in El Salvador
ILOPANGO, El Salvador—Members of a combined U.S., Salvadoran damage assessment team disembark a Joint Task Force-Bravo UH-60 helicopter Nov. 13 in an area affected by landslides caused by recent heavy rains. Engineers from U.S. Southern Command, together with Salvadoran military engineers, are assisting El Salvador’s Ministry of Health gathering data from areas with damaged infrastructure. Joint Task Force-Bravo, based out of Soto Cano Air Base, Honduras, has been helping in El Salvador since Nov. 11, providing humanitarian assistance and disaster relief to flood-damaged communities (U.S. Air Force photo/1st Lt. Jennifer Richard).
